99问答网
所有问题
当前搜索:
进行软件结构设计遵循的最主要原理
在
进行软件结构设计
时应该
遵循的最主要
的原因是什么
原理
答:
在进行软件结构设计时应该遵循的最主要的原理是开闭原则
。开闭原则是在面向对象编程领域中,规定“软件中的对象(类,模块,函数等等)对于扩展是开放的,但是对于修改是封闭的,这意味着一个实体是允许在不改变它的源代码的前提下变更它的行为。
软件设计
应
遵循的
原则是什么?
答:
七、合成复用原则(Composite Reuse Principle,CRP):如果两个软件实体无须直接通信,那么就不应当发生直接的相互调用,可以通过第三方转发该调用。这7种设计原则是软件设计模式必须尽量遵循的原则,各种原则要求的侧重点不同。其中,
开闭原则是总纲
,它告诉我们要对扩展开放,对修改关闭;里氏替换原则告诉我...
...的
结构
化
设计
(sd)方法,全面指导模块划分
的最重要
原则应该是( )_百...
答:
软件开发的结构化设计(SD)方法,
全面指导模块划分的最重要原则是:模块独立性
。
软件设计
过程中应该
遵循的基本原理
答:
软件设计过程中应该遵循的基本原理如下:编程语言:掌握至少一种编程语言
,例如Java、Python等。数据结构与算法:了解数据结构和算法的基础知识,例如数组、链表、栈、队列、排序算法、查找算法等。软件设计模式:了解常用的软件设计模式,例如单例模式、工厂模式、观察者模式等。软件工程:掌握软件开发的过程和...
软件
总体
设计
过程中需要
遵守
哪些
基本原理
答:
(1)用分阶段的生存周期计划进行严格的管理
。 (2)坚持进行阶段评审。 (3)实行严格的产品控制。 (4)采用现代程序设计技术。 (5)软件工程结果应能清楚地审查。 (6)开发小组的人员应该少而精。 (7)承认不断改进软件工程实践的必要性。 B.Boehm指出,遵循前六条基本原理,能够实现软件的工程化生产;按照第七条原理...
结构
化
设计基本原理
和相关概念
答:
在
软件设计
中,
结构
化方法
遵循
一系列
基本原理
和相关概念,以实现高效、易于理解和维护的系统架构。首先,抽象化是关键,包括过程抽象、数据抽象和控制抽象。过程抽象允许我们将复杂的操作视为独立的单元,即使其内部由一系列操作组成。数据抽象则让我们在不同层次上描述数据对象,隐藏其细节。控制抽象则提供了...
软件
开发的
结构
化
设计
方法,全面指导模块划分
的最重要
原则应该是...
答:
【答案】:C 全面指导模块划分
的最重要
原则是模块独立性。做到模块独立就是每个模块完成一个相对独立的特定子功能,并且和其他模块之间的关系很简单。有效的模块化(即具有独立的模块)的
软件
比较容易开发出来;独立的模块比较容易测试和维护。
结构
化程序
设计的
工作
原理
是什么
答:
结构是指系统内各个组成要素之间的相互联系、相互作用的框架。结构化开发方法提出了一组提高
软件结构
合理性的准则,如分解与抽象、模块独立性、信息隐蔽等。针对软件生存周期各个不同的阶段,它有结构化分析(SA)、结构化
设计
(SD)和结构化程序设计(SP)等方法。结构化分析方法给出一组帮助系统分析人员产生...
在
进行软件设计
时,以下
结构设计
原则中,不正确的是()。
答:
为了保证系设计工作的顺利
进行
,
结构设计
应
遵循
如下原则:(1)所划分的模块其内部的凝聚性要强,模块之间的联系要少,即模块具有较强的独立性。(2)模块之间的连接只能存在上下级之间的调用关系,不能有同级之间的横向联系。(3)整个系统呈树状结构,不允许网状结构或交叉调用关系出现。(4)所有模块(...
结构
化程序实现
的基本原理
答:
2. 逐步细化 3. 模块化
设计
4.
结构
化编码 结构化程序设计由迪克斯特拉(E.W.dijkstra)在1969年提出,是以模块化设计为中心,将待开发的
软件
系统划分为若干个相互独立的模块,这样使完成每一个模块的工作变单纯而明确,为设计一些较大的软件打下了良好的基础。由于模块相互独立,因此在设计其中一个...
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
其他人还搜
软件结构设计基本原理
结构设计的基本原理
轴的设计包括结构设计和
结构设计原理
机械结构设计原理
荷载与结构设计原理
结构设计原理配筋
结构设计原理规范
结构设计原理叶见曙第4版